If you have searched to understand loved ones who have left their religious faith, this show is for you. As a mother of six out of seven children who have chosen a different path from the one they were raised in, I intimately understand the profound struggle this journey entails. Faith or Attachment Issue? - With Lindsay Schiess
Q: What are two simple questions that can foster understanding and reduce fear in the relationship?
Ask, 'What's it like for you?' and 'Tell me more about what you're experiencing,' to show that you see and care for the other person.
Faith or Attachment Issue? - With Lindsay Schiess
Q: What can people do to help those who are in the church feel safe when someone they love leaves?
Honor your own experience and grief first, create safety by listening rather than debating, and ask simple questions that invite understanding rather than forcing agreement.

Frequently Asked Questions About Just Love Them

What is Just Love Them about and what kind of topics does it cover?

A compassionate show focused on families navigating loved ones' departures from their religious upbringing. Across episodes, hosts and guests share personal stories, practical strategies, and faith-centered guidance to foster forgiveness, boundaries, and lasting connection. The conversations frequently center on self-care, healthy communication, and navigating difficult conversations with empathy, making it a trusted resource for parents and caregivers seeking actionable steps and hope in the face of estrangement or shifts in belief. A standout aspect is the blend of personal narrative with therapeutic and spiritual frameworks, plus ongoing emphasis on staying connected while honoring individual paths.
